Bachelor's degree holders qualify for BCS membership and, with appropriate professional experience, can pursue Chartered IT Professional (CITP) status along with partial Chartered Scientist (CSci) or Chartered Engineer (CEng) credentials. MSci graduates qualify for full CITP and partial CSci recognition. Our bachelor's programs carry the Euro-Inf Bachelor Quality certification, while MSci degrees hold the Euro-Inf Master Quality Label.
